About Wandsworth

Wandsworth is a district located in Greater London, England, within the SW6 postcode area. It is situated on the south bank of the River Thames, providing easy access to various riverside paths and parks. The area features a mix of residential housing, shops, and local amenities, making it a practical choice for both families and professionals. Wandsworth Common, a large green space, is a popular spot for outdoor activities and relaxation. The district is well-connected by public transport, with several train stations and bus routes serving the area. Wandsworth’s high street offers a variety of shops, cafes, and restaurants, catering to a range of tastes and preferences. The local community is diverse, contributing to the area's lively atmosphere. Overall, Wandsworth provides a blend of urban living with access to green spaces and essential services.

School Ratings in Wandsworth

There are 772 schools in and around Wandsworth. St John's Walham Green Church of England Primary School, L'Ecole des Petits School, The London Oratory School and Lady Margaret School are each rated Outstanding by Ofsted. A further 9 schools hold a Good rating.

House Prices in Wandsworth

The average property price is £1.3M, with flats making up the majority of the housing stock at around £778K.

Crime and Anti-Social Behaviour in Wandsworth

Recorded crime levels are higher than the national average. Anti-social behaviour is prevalent across Wandsworth, with 589 recorded incidents in January 2026.
